Measure not totalling correctly when using if statement

I am working on a headcount report and trying to do the following:

 

Remaining Attrition = round(-([2023_EndHC]*0.015)-[Q4_Terms],0)

- 1.5% is what we think our attrition could be

- The Attrition Measure is using 2 other measures to calculate the data

- This measure shows up in the table matrix well and totals correctly

 

However, I want to say that if the Attrition is Positive, have it equal to 0 and if the Attrition is positive, the equal Attrition

 

Attrition Updated = IF([RemainingAttrition]>0,0,[RemainingAttrition])

 

This works for each line item however, it does not total up for me correctly 😞 I havent gotten it to work afte reading multilple posts.

 Thank you for your question. Based on the information you have provided, You can try to change the measure:

Attrition Updated Corrected =

SUMX (

    VALUES (TableName[CategoryColumn] ),

    IF ( [RemainingAttrition] > 0, 0, [RemainingAttrition] )

)
